I'm on a major Batman kick (literally?!) this week thanks to Batman Arkham Asylum. Swooping down on escaped inmates and kicking them in the face. It's good times. Or sneaking up behind a guy, smothering him, dropping him gently to the floor and then grappling up to a gargoyle to watch as his comrades discover his unconscious body and freak out. Batman's my kind of guy.

Probably the best part about the game, though, is the voice acting. They got Mark Hamill as the Joker and Kevin Conroy as Batman, which is the dream team from the animated series back in my golden childhood. Same Harley, too, but sometimes she delivers her lines pretty bad. The rest of the voice acting is spotty, a lot of bland readings, really. Wish they'd got someone of the Hamill/Conroy caliber for the Riddler, because he's my fave and his voice is alllllllllllll over the game.
